Output f674780240c539e524af7eec68001f2b3f22120486ad01c20d9e88ddd67df474:0

value
18049046
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ca8083aba34c6ca4491a2c37c4f832409450295 OP_EQUALVERIFY OP_CHECKSIG
address
129vQP3qiARpsuSVPnX1NXJz6DErvRnYMB
transaction
f674780240c539e524af7eec68001f2b3f22120486ad01c20d9e88ddd67df474
confirmations
581930
spent
true